Some colleges also require a background in math biology chemistry and anatomy which will help them in radiology studies. 4683065 FS applicants may be certified by endorsement if they meet all the requirements listed above and can demonstrate that they hold a current Radiologic Technology certificate license or registration in another jurisdiction which is substantially equivalent in the Departments opinion to the Florida certificate. You will seek approval to test from the state of Florida. Be of good moral character. According to the Florida Department of Health to obtain a radiology technicians license in the state of Florida you are required to obtain certification through an exam and a degree from an accredited two year Radiologic Technology program.
